Attaching the Lens / Detaching the Lens

Before replacing the projection lens

Return the projection lens to the home position before replacing or removing it.
For details on how to return the lens to the home position, refer to the operating instructions of the projector.
Attention
z Make sure that the projector power supply is switched off before attaching or detaching the projection lens.
z After removing the projection lens, store it safely away from vibration or impacts.
z Do not touch the electric contact points of the projection lens with your fingers. Dust and dirt on the contacts
may cause contact malfunctions.
z Before attaching the Fixed-focus lens, remove the protective film from the light projecting surface and the lens
cap from the lens.
Lens cap
z Be sure not to touch the light projecting surface or the surface of the lens. Any fingerprints or smudges on
these surfaces will be magnified and lower the quality of the image displayed on the screen.
z The light projecting surface and lens are made of glass. The lens could be damaged if brought into contact
with or rubbed against hard objects. Handle the lens carefully.
z Use a clean, soft and dry cloth to wipe away any dirt or dust that has adhered to the light projecting surface or lens.
Do not use fluffy cloths containing oil, water or dust for cleaning.
z When the Fixed-focus lens is removed from the projector, place it with the light projecting surface facing
downwards.
